Yes, the City of Regina requires building permits for any structural changes, as well as specific trade permits for plumbing and electrical work. Basic cosmetic updates like painting or replacing a faucet typically do not require one, but a full remodel does.
The Saskatchewan Secondary Suite Incentive (SSI) Grant can provide up to $35,000 or 35% of the cost to build a new secondary suite, which often includes a full bathroom renovation if converting a basement or adding a legal rental unit.
A new basement bathroom installation in Regina typically starts at $11,500 for a basic 3-piece setup, but can rise to $14,000+ if significant concrete cutting for new plumbing lines is required.
In older Regina neighborhoods (like Cathedral or Lakeview), homeowners should budget an extra 15% contingency for potential asbestos remediation, lead pipe replacement, or subfloor rot, which are frequently discovered during demolition.
